COPY command error

8 New Member
I used the copy command as stateed below, to copy a file containing data, which I want to load into my evaluations table. I get the following error, can some one explain to me what I may be doing wrong.

COPY evaluations FROM 'c:\evaluations .txt'
DELIMITERS ':';


WARNING: nonstandard use of escape in a string literal
LINE 1: COPY evaluations FROM 'c:\evaluations .txt'
^
HINT: Use the escape string syntax for escapes, e.g., E'\r\n'.

ERROR: could not open file "c:evaluations. txt" for reading: No such file or directory
SQL state: 58P01
